Transaction d3bba2704f5a08f01c814d0ab15115a3f2d3e40b4042b62393612780f523069f
1 Input
1 Output
-
d3bba2704f5a08f01c814d0ab15115a3f2d3e40b4042b62393612780f523069f:0
- value
- 584397
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a165ee1427f541146816a2029beacacfaf39d9c2 OP_EQUAL
- address
- 3GQQpeaNVfekn7kkvdYSyUPL7rqvum7mgM